Commit Graph

1687 Commits

Author SHA1 Message Date
stefanprodan
6cfa432834 Retry canary initialization on conflict 2020-05-14 11:03:32 +03:00
Stefan Prodan
474a5a20be Merge pull request #584 from weaveworks/appmesh-v1beta2
Implement AppMesh v1beta2 router
2020-05-14 09:38:08 +03:00
Stefan Prodan
af02ed46a5 Merge pull request #585 from tr-srij/patch-1
Fix typo in loadtester chart readme
2020-05-14 09:36:13 +03:00
tr-srij
972596f443 Update README.md 2020-05-13 23:30:51 -04:00
stefanprodan
6498cccb85 Use target port for virtual routers
AppMesh does not support port mappings
2020-05-13 22:50:26 +03:00
stefanprodan
6c9847ae14 Use FQDN for virtual nodes DNS 2020-05-13 22:43:10 +03:00
stefanprodan
b0b0cedde1 Map target port for virtual node listeners 2020-05-13 17:26:36 +03:00
Stefan Prodan
d96672eec1 Merge pull request #581 from edtan/fix-dev-link
Fix broken link to Flagger Development Guide
2020-05-12 09:46:22 +03:00
Ed
fed6948dab Fix broken link to Flagger Development Guide 2020-05-11 23:35:56 -04:00
stefanprodan
86939d9dce Register AppMesh VirtualNodes before Deployment init 2020-05-08 13:16:19 +03:00
stefanprodan
854d7665f0 Add AppMesh v1beta2 to factories 2020-05-08 13:15:37 +03:00
stefanprodan
52c757250a Fix annotations diff 2020-05-08 13:14:50 +03:00
stefanprodan
fe1d85b0ce Add AppMesh v1beta2 router tests 2020-05-08 13:13:27 +03:00
stefanprodan
0aac94b782 Implement AppMesh v1beta2 router 2020-05-08 13:12:58 +03:00
Stefan Prodan
e55af2ff19 Merge pull request #579 from jlbutler/fix-link
broken link in tutorials section of gitbook
2020-05-07 11:37:27 +03:00
Jesse Butler
2e388fceee fix broken link in tutorials section of gitbook
Signed-off-by: Jesse Butler <butlerjl@amazon.com>
2020-05-06 19:55:14 -04:00
stefanprodan
2d1c4a9d84 Use API providers in observer factory 2020-05-06 01:14:41 +03:00
stefanprodan
004eb88962 Add Envoy metric templates to docs 2020-05-06 01:13:42 +03:00
stefanprodan
eba6478729 Add providers to API 2020-05-06 01:12:41 +03:00
stefanprodan
7686b4b01a Generate AppMesh v1beta2 client 2020-05-05 19:31:03 +03:00
stefanprodan
55c89770d7 Add AppMesh v1beta2 clientset and RBAC 2020-05-04 22:22:51 +03:00
Stefan Prodan
d6f3a2453b Merge pull request #576 from weaveworks/deps-update
Update packages and e2e to Kubernetes v1.18.2
2020-05-02 12:12:09 +03:00
stefanprodan
d320b558d0 e2e: Update Kind, Istio and Linkerd
- Kind v0.8.1 (Kubernetes 1.18.2)
- Istio v1.5.2
- Linkerd stable-2.7.1
2020-05-02 09:39:55 +03:00
stefanprodan
66203c0916 build: Update Kubernetes client-go to 1.18.2 2020-05-02 08:54:22 +03:00
Stefan Prodan
d97a8cbc01 Merge pull request #575 from heubeck/master
Add MediaMarktSaturn to list of users
2020-05-02 08:42:25 +03:00
Florian Heubeck
6bb47f2e5d Add MediaMarktSaturn to list of users
Signed-off-by: Florian Heubeck <heubeck@mediamarktsaturn.com>
2020-05-01 23:30:34 +02:00
Stefan Prodan
f89f0d6515 Merge pull request #571 from edtan/fix-deployment-alert-test
controller: fix deployment alerts unit test
2020-04-30 11:02:37 +03:00
Ed
f46eaa8d05 This makes the primary ready in the TestScheduler_DeploymentAlerts test
in order to send out an alert.  Previously, it did not reach a state
to send an alert.
2020-04-30 00:20:25 -04:00
Takeshi Yoneda
e3f18b3d7e Merge pull request #565 from GijsvanDulmen/fix-rocket-test
Fix rocket tests naming but keep structs
2020-04-27 20:42:59 +09:00
Gijs van Dulmen
2b7a95fee5 Fix slack naming as well in tests 2020-04-27 13:13:46 +02:00
Gijs van Dulmen
647eb81021 Fix naming but keep structs 2020-04-27 09:46:13 +02:00
Stefan Prodan
bda620aae9 Merge pull request #560 from tariq1890/fix_lint
fix issues reported by the linter
2020-04-18 11:12:38 +03:00
Tariq Ibrahim
d41ed43ef9 fix issues reported by the linter 2020-04-17 11:45:44 -07:00
Stefan Prodan
86d3b498b6 Merge pull request #561 from tariq1890/no_kutils
remove unnecessary dependency on k/utils
2020-04-17 09:28:10 +03:00
Tariq Ibrahim
e473d4b2fb remove unnecessary dependency on k/utils 2020-04-16 16:14:08 -07:00
Stefan Prodan
fcac3380d7 Merge pull request #559 from weaveworks/e2e-istio-1.5.1
ci: Update end-to-end test to Istio 1.5.1
2020-04-16 13:06:05 +03:00
stefanprodan
f5fd57f3df Use Kubernetes v1.16 in Istio e2e 2020-04-16 12:05:58 +03:00
stefanprodan
2c6259495b Update end-to-end tests to Istio 1.5.1 2020-04-16 11:50:46 +03:00
Takeshi Yoneda
0d1e41504c Merge pull request #557 from n0rad/master
Check prometheus is online with simple query
2020-04-15 22:27:42 +09:00
Arnaud Lemaire
4a4f8555df Check prometheus is online with simple query 2020-04-15 10:29:05 +02:00
Stefan Prodan
4890a71283 Merge pull request #538 from splunk/feature/user-specified-labels-annotations
Add user-specified labels/annotations to Canary for generated Services
2020-04-09 20:41:07 +03:00
stefanprodan
84dd0006ca Add service metadata update unit test 2020-04-04 17:16:49 +03:00
stefanprodan
8d37b7b20b Update service metadata if ownerRef kind is canary 2020-04-04 16:52:12 +03:00
Finn Herzfeld
3f961ae73f Handle annotations/labels update 2020-04-04 16:52:12 +03:00
Finn Herzfeld
4460cb7385 Fix CRD indentation 2020-04-04 16:48:35 +03:00
stefanprodan
37527854d2 Add e2e test for apex service custom metadata 2020-04-04 16:48:35 +03:00
stefanprodan
c609a90959 Add unit tests for service custom metadata 2020-04-04 16:48:35 +03:00
Finn Herzfeld
2657e135b8 Use pointers for metadata because it is optional
and metadata parameter is nil on finalize.

in response to PR feedback
2020-04-04 16:48:35 +03:00
Finn Herzfeld
b7441a7ce7 Fix call to reconcileService 2020-04-04 16:48:35 +03:00
Finn Herzfeld
0aee385145 log canary.spec.service for debugging purposes 2020-04-04 16:48:35 +03:00